The property market in GL50 3PF is characterised by a high proportion of rental properties, with only 35% of homes owned by residents. Flats make up the majority of the housing stock, reflecting a focus on compact, urban-style living. This suggests the area is more suited to individuals or couples seeking affordable, manageable spaces rather than families requiring larger homes. The limited size of the postcode means the housing options are constrained, and buyers should consider the surrounding areas for more variety. The prevalence of flats also indicates a reliance on shared facilities and communal spaces, which may appeal to those prioritising convenience over private outdoor areas. For investors, the rental market here may offer steady returns, though property values are unlikely to be high given the area’s modest scale.

The community in GL50 3PF is predominantly young, with a median age of 22 and the most common age range being 15–29 years. This reflects a demographic skewed toward students, graduates, and young professionals, often linked to nearby educational institutions. Home ownership is relatively low at 35%, with flats being the primary accommodation type. This suggests a rental market dominates, catering to transient or budget-conscious residents. The predominant ethnic group is White, though specific data on diversity beyond this is not provided. The area’s youthful profile means it lacks the generational mix seen in older communities, which can influence local social dynamics. For buyers, this demographic profile may translate to a demand for short-term or flexible housing solutions rather than family-oriented properties.
